About the event

🗓 Date: Oct 9, 2025

🕙 Time: 10:00 AM (Vilnius time)

⏱ Duration: 1.5 hours

📍 Location: Online

🎙️ Speaker: Eglė Kontautaitė, AML/CFT Expert at AMLTRIX, Head of Customer Solutions at AMLYZE, Expert at Ellex


🔍 Topic: SEPA Instant – Balancing Speed and Compliance in Real Time


Description:This session explores how instant payments reshape compliance in practice. Participants will examine regulatory updates, sanction screening reliefs, fraud prevention measures, and AML/CFT challenges within the 10-second execution window. Special focus will be given to Verification of Payee, sanctions dataset updates, and the “freeze vs. execute” dilemma, helping compliance professionals develop strategies to balance speed with regulatory obligations.


Learning Objectives: By the end of this session, participants will be able to:

  • Recognize the compliance challenges created by real-time execution.

  • Apply practical strategies to balance speed with compliance obligations.


Agenda:

  • Introduction: “SEPA Instant in 10 seconds” – regulatory changes and challenges (transaction flow, decision making within 10 seconds, partial relief in sanction screening requirements, fraud management).

  • Verification of Payee (VoP): benefits & limitations. Ex-ante approach in the forthcoming payment services package vs. SEPA Instant regulation.

  • Sanctions compliance: Immediate dataset updates; limited removal of transaction-by-transaction screening obligations; gaps around national, extraterritorial, and sectoral sanctions; payment purpose checks.

  • AML/CFT conundrum: freeze vs. instant execution – the “to be or not to be” dilemma.
